Complex number are usually written as a+ib , where ‘a’, ‘b’ are real and iota (i) is used to denote −1 ,If we have term as c+ida+ib , it mean a+ib is divided by c+id to divide the complex number. We will follow the following step –
Step 1: Firstly we find the conjugate of the denominator .
Step 2: We will multiply numerator and denominator of the given fraction by the conjugate of the denominator.
Step 3: We will then distribute the term mean
We will produce the term in numerator as well as in denominator.
Step 4: We will simplify the power of I, always remember that i2 is given as -1.
Step 5: We will then combine the like term that means we will iota involving terms with each other and only constant with each other.
Step 6: We will simply answer our answer lastly in standard complex form a+ib .
